McCaig Tower

Was at the Foothills on the weekend to visit one of my fiances friends whose husband is battling brain cancer, and we went for a bit of a walk to explore the new McCaig Tower while we were there. So far its mostly day surgery units that have been moved over, 4 of 7 floors are at least accessible from the elevators, but its pretty empty still.

More seating, some future retail type bays and at the far north end a glass elevator that goes down into the parkade below.


Family Room on 3rd Floor by Jason R. Reid, on Flickr

A fairly large family room was built on the 3rd floor. This shows only half the room, the other half contains more chairs, and a childrens play structure. There is also a private family room beside this room with couches, a TV and even a computer workstation.

The main entrance and admitting area. This was originally intended to be the main admitting area for the entire Foothills Campus, but they decided to leave that in the old main tower after this was mostly constructed. Yes, that is a huge fireplace, and theres a baby grand piano tucked in the corner as well.
